Transaction 8768c2091b7566888ff4f64c79601dabf61d84037637a1af76c73532dc4fd98a
1 Input
1 Output
-
8768c2091b7566888ff4f64c79601dabf61d84037637a1af76c73532dc4fd98a:0
- value
- 298118
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a5186a8dc6312d81cdc8388cdd752d6d268e580 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13QAEWqJH8ZkPwRFHm87Wo9JSzPpqdj4g7